APPLESAUCE RAISIN MUFFINS

Time 40m

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 11

2 cups all-purpose flour
¾ cup white sugar
2 teaspoons baking powder
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
¼ teaspoon salt
½ cup coconut butter
1 extra large egg
1 ½ cups unsweetened applesauce
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 cup raisins
½ cup crushed walnuts

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Line a 12-cup muffin tin with paper liners.
  • Mix flour, sugar, baking powder, cinnamon, and salt together in a large bowl.
  • Melt coconut butter in a small bowl. Beat egg into the butter and pour into the flour mixture. Mix in applesauce and vanilla extract. Fold in raisins and walnuts and mix into a doughy batter.
  • Scoop batter into the muffin liners using an ice cream scoop.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until tops spring back when lightly pressed, 18 to 20 minutes. Let muffins cool for about 5 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 267.4 calories, Carbohydrate 44.5 g, Cholesterol 18 mg, Fat 9.1 g, Fiber 3.2 g, Protein 4.5 g, SaturatedFat 5.1 g, Sodium 141.8 mg, Sugar 23 g
